1// SPDX-License-Identifier: (GPL-2.0-or-later OR MIT) 2/* 3 * Copyright 2018-2022 TQ-Systems GmbH 4 * Author: Markus Niebel <[email protected]> 5 */ 6 7/dts-v1/; 8 9#include "imx6ul-tqma6ul2.dtsi" 10#include "mba6ulx.dtsi" 11#include "imx6ul-tqma6ul1.dtsi" 12 13/ { 14 model = "TQ-Systems TQMa6UL1 SoM on MBa6ULx board"; 15 compatible = "tq,imx6ul-tqma6ul1-mba6ulx", "tq,imx6ul-tqma6ul1", "fsl,imx6ul"; 16}; 17 18/* 19 * Note: can2 and fec2 are enabled on mba6ulx level (for i.MX6ULG2 usage) 20 * and need to be disabled here again 21 */ 22&can2 { 23 status = "disabled"; 24}; 25 26&fec1 { 27 pinctrl-names = "default"; 28 pinctrl-0 = <&pinctrl_enet1>, <&pinctrl_enet1_mdc>; 29 status = "okay"; 30 31 mdio { 32 #address-cells = <1>; 33 #size-cells = <0>; 34 35 ethphy0: ethernet-phy@0 { 36 compatible = "ethernet-phy-ieee802.3-c22"; 37 max-speed = <100>; 38 reg = <0>; 39 }; 40 }; 41}; 42 43&fec2 { 44 /delete-property/ phy-handle; 45 /delete-node/ mdio; 46}; 47 48&iomuxc { 49 pinctrl_enet1_mdc: enet1mdcgrp { 50 fsl,pins = < 51 /* mdio */ 52 MX6UL_PAD_GPIO1_IO07__ENET1_MDC 0x1b0b0 53 MX6UL_PAD_GPIO1_IO06__ENET1_MDIO 0x1b0b0 54 >; 55 }; 56}; 57